Key Features to Look For

When buying a 360 car camera, consider these features:

  • Number of Cameras: Most systems use four cameras. They are placed on the front, back, and sides. This gives you a full 360-degree view.
  • Resolution: Look for high resolution. Higher resolution means a clearer picture. You can see more details.
  • Night Vision: Good night vision is important. It helps you see clearly in the dark. Look for cameras with infrared (IR) lights.
  • Parking Assist: Many cameras offer parking assist features. These features help you park safely. Some systems show parking lines.
  • Recording Capabilities: Make sure the camera records. Look for a camera that records to an SD card. This lets you save important videos.
  • Connectivity: Some cameras connect to your phone. This makes viewing and sharing videos easy. They may use Wi-Fi or Bluetooth.

User Experience and Use Cases

A 360 car camera improves the driving experience. Here are some use cases:

Parking: The camera makes parking easier. You can see all obstacles. This helps you avoid bumps and scratches.

Maneuvering: You can see what is around your car when you are driving slowly. You can see if you have space to get around objects.

Safety: The camera records everything. It can provide evidence if there is an accident. It can also help prevent accidents.

Blind Spot Monitoring: The camera can help you see your blind spots. This is great when you are changing lanes.

Q: How does a 360 car camera work?

Four cameras strategically positioned around your vehicle capture a panoramic vista, feeding a powerful processor that stitches these feeds into a seamless 360-degree perspective, all conveniently projected onto your car’s display.
